This article presents qualitative data from a mixed-methods study assessing the impact that therapeutic theatre (TT) had on resilience among adolescents at-risk of high school dropout. Weekly after-school drama therapy groups developed a performance as part of ENACT's annual live production Show UP!. Findings showed that participation in an action-oriented process in school settings can promote positive change among youth, increase interpersonal connections and provide greater self-awareness and social awareness. Implications of these findings support TT as beneficial in stabilizing indicators of dropout, growing protective factors and sustaining resilience in adolescents. Future directions for research and practice are discussed.
